• 201608009 <br />14. Boats. Each Lake Lot Owner and Permitted Estate Lot Owner shall be limited to <br />two (2) boats, which can be used on Ponderosa Lake. All boats shall be registered with the <br />Association. Each Lake Lot Owner and Permitted Estate Lot Owner will be given a sticker for <br />each registered boat, and this sticker must be prominently displayed on the left bow side of the <br />boat. Nonresidents, Non Lake Lot Owners and Non Permitted Estate Lot Owners do not have <br />the right of boat usage on Ponderosa Lake. <br />15. Ponderosa Lake Usage. <br />A. Non Lake Lot Owners and Non Permitted Estate Lot Owners shall access <br />Ponderosa Lake only at the designated common areas. Usage of Ponderosa Lake by Non Lake <br />Lot Owners and Non Permitted Estate Lot Owners are limited to fishing, swimming, ice skating, <br />and similar usage. The Owner of each Lot agrees to use Ponderosa Lake in such a manner as <br />not to interfere with the use of the Lake by any other person and in such manner as to not create <br />any nuisance, annoyance or unlawful disturbance. The Owners of all Lots shall be responsible <br />for the conduct and safety of their guests. If a complaint is filed with the Association alleging <br />negligent or obnoxious behavior towards other boaters, Owners or their guests, the accused will <br />receive notice from the Association, and a subsequent hearing will be held before the Board of <br />Directors of the Association. If a homeowner receives two (2) notices, his or her rights may be <br />restricted. <br />B. Water skiing is allowed on the lake using registered boats owned by Lake <br />Lot Owners and Permitted Estate Lot Owners. There shall be a "no wake" zone within ninety <br />(90) feet from any shoreline. No jet skis, jet boats, vehicles, ATVs, or like equipment shall be <br />allowed on Ponderosa Lake and beaches. All Lot Owners and occupants acknowledge that <br />Ponderosa Lake is potentially dangerous, and there shall be no liability of any kind upon the <br />Owners, subdividers or the Association. The use of Ponderosa Lake by any Lot Owner and their <br />guests shall be at their sole risk. <br />C. The Association has the right to temporarily disallow water sports entirely. <br />The decision to temporarily disallow water sports shall be made by the Board of Directors at a <br />special meeting. <br />D. The use of Ponderosa Lake shall be restricted to Owners of Lots and their <br />guests. <br />
